Which companies sponsor visas for partnership development managers in Colorado?
Technology and enterprise software companies are the most active sponsors for partnership development manager roles in Colorado. Palantir, headquartered in Denver, has a consistent track record of H-1B sponsorship. Salesforce, Oracle, and Arrow Electronics also maintain Colorado offices with established sponsorship programs. Larger enterprise firms in the Denver Tech Center are generally more likely to sponsor than early-stage startups, which often lack the legal infrastructure to support visa petitions.
Which visa types are most common for partnership development manager roles in Colorado?
The H-1B is the most commonly used visa for partnership development managers in Colorado, as the role typically requires a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or a related field, qualifying it as a specialty occupation. Candidates with Canadian or Mexican citizenship may pursue the TN visa under the NAFTA/USMCA category for management consultants or business professionals. Australian citizens can explore the E-3 visa, which has no lottery and significantly shorter processing timelines than the H-1B.
Which cities in Colorado have the most partnership development manager sponsorship jobs?
Denver accounts for the largest share of partnership development manager sponsorship activity in Colorado, driven by its concentration of technology firms, SaaS companies, and Fortune 500 regional headquarters in the Denver Tech Center. Boulder is a secondary hub, particularly for growth-stage software companies with venture backing. Colorado Springs sees more limited activity but has partnership roles tied to defense technology and government contracting firms operating in that market.

Are there state-specific considerations for partnership development manager sponsorship in Colorado?
Colorado's Equal Pay for Equal Work Act requires employers to disclose compensation ranges in job postings, which gives international candidates useful context when evaluating whether a role meets prevailing wage requirements under H-1B regulations. The state's competitive tech labor market means prevailing wages for partnership development managers are generally strong, which can work in candidates' favor during the Labor Condition Application process. Colorado's university pipeline, including CU Boulder and University of Denver, also produces business graduates who have established OPT-to-sponsorship pathways with local employers.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ored partnership development manager jobs in Colorado?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
